Output 671020a142df2c1726c64635bbc1650decdfd482e4f5abd6cc87939b9c6bf739:2

value
331593380
script pubkey
OP_0 OP_PUSHBYTES_20 8d1e89b9a349d4047b7efc6f09d6c438dee0d556
address
bc1q350gnwdrf82qg7m7l3hsn4ky8r0wp42k53pxf2
transaction
671020a142df2c1726c64635bbc1650decdfd482e4f5abd6cc87939b9c6bf739
spent
true